Lee Kang-in (21, Mallorca) was included in the team of the week in the top 5 European leagues with a rating of 9 points. Of course, the Primera Liga was also on the team of the week.
On the 18th (Korean time), ‘Whoscored.com’, a soccer statistics company, placed the most outstanding players in the Premier League, Bundesliga, Primera Liga, Serie A and Ligue 1 by position. Lee Kang-in, who received a rating of 9.1 in the match against Celta Vigo, showed off his dignity by being included in the waist.

Lee Kang-in led the Mallorca attack with his unique soft ball guard, dribbling, and penetrating pass. He moved from the left as a free-roll and recorded 4 key passes and a 91% passing success rate. He also had three aerial fights and his free kicks were sharp.
His focus is on his dribbling. He shook Celta Vigo with exquisite dribbling, and according to ‘Opta’, a football media, he broke through the dribble 9 times. It was the first record in 13 years and 4 months since Gonzalo Castro against Osasuna in December 2009.
For his overwhelming performance, he received a rating of 9.1 based on ‘Who Scored.com’. ‘Foot Mob’ was also selected as the Man of the Match (MOM) and applauded Lee Kang-in’s performance. It was a higher rating than Ndiaye, who scored the winning goal by shaking the Celta Vigo net.
According to ‘whoscored.com’, he was listed as the team of the week in the top 5 European leagues. He was named the best player along with Kylian Mbappe (Rating 9.2) and others. Of course, he also swept the Primera Liga team of the week. He stood shoulder to shoulder with Antoine Griezmann (9.1 points), Karim Benzema (8.3 points) and Rodrygo (8.2 points).
Lee Kang-in has been at the center of transfer rumors since last winter. Although Mallorca talked about a buyout and became a bubble, this summer is expected to be unstoppable. He has been linked with big clubs like Atletico Madrid, Manchester City and Wolverhampton.
